March 2022
Intermediate to advanced
208 pages
2h 18m
Japanese
ここまでSphinxとreST記法を使って簡単な文章を書く方法やHTMLへのビルド方法などを学びました。HTMLはほとんどのOSやデバイスで開くことができて扱いやすいフォーマットですが、完成した文書を配布したい場合や、業務で利用したい場合など、HTMLではなくPDFで出力できると嬉しい場面があります。
そこで、本章では作成した文章をPDFに変換する方法を紹介します。
前の章では議事録を例にとってHTMLへの変換を学びましたが、単に議事録をPDFに変換するだけではページ数が少なく、例としてはあまりおもしろくありません。今度はPythonのインストール手順書を例にしてPDFへの変換方法を紹介します。
SphinxはreSTフォーマットの文書をPDFに変換する際、一度 TeX (テフ、テック)形式の文書に変換してから、その後にPDFに変換するという二段階の変換を行います。TeXからPDFへの変換は自動的に行われるため、利用者はTeXの知識がなくとも、高品質なPDFに変換できます。
図4-1: TeX形式を経由した二段階の変換
そのため、reSTからPDFへの変換にはTeX用のツールを必要とします。TeX用のツールはTeX Live(macOSの場合はMacTeX)として配布されているので、これをインストールしてください。TeX Live/MacTeXのインストール方法は巻末の ...
Read now
Unlock full access